Chilly chicken an amalgamation of India and China........as everybody knows its an Indo-Chinese dish. The flavor, and a punch of heat with the diced capsicum and onion everybody loves it. Well, I prefer chilly mushrooms than chilly chicken, but this tastes really good........!! Every Indian enjoys this dish at restaurants or hawker store with some noodles..... INGREDIENTS- 250 gms boneless chicken breast (cut into 1-inch cubes) 1 egg white 1 tsp salt 4 tsp red chilly sauce 2 -3 tsp cornflour 1 tbsp soy sauce 2 tbsp tomato ketchup 1 tsp white vinegar 2 tbsp oil 1/2 tsp ginger paste 1 tsp garlic paste 1 big onion sliced long 1/2 cup capsicum (cut into big cubes) 1 -2 green chilies Green coriander and green onion for garnish Oil for frying PROCEDURE- Marinate the chicken pieces in egg white, 1 tsp salt, 2 tsp red chilly sauce and 2 -3 tsp cornflour. Mix well and keep for 10 - 15 minutes. In a bowl mix 2 tsp red chilly sauce, soy sauce, tomato ketchup, and w...

For vegetarians , there is prototype of samosa's, i.e; triangles made of refined flour stuffed with mashed potatoes, peas,chilly mixture. Contrary, to this, for us non-vegetarians (i might sound discriminating :p ) samosa's has a diversity, sometimes stuffed with potatoes, sometimes with minced chicken,beef or mutton.
